    powerpc: Make rwsem use "long" type · 529b7307
    Benjamin Herrenschmidt 提交于
    This makes the 64-bit kernel use 64-bit signed integers for the counter
    (effectively supporting 32-bit of active count in the semaphore), thus
    avoiding things like overflow of the mmap_sem if you use a really crazy
    number of threads
    
    Note: Ideally the type in the structure should be atomic_long_t rather
    than "long". However, there's some nasty issues with that. It needs to
    be initialized statically -and- lib/rwsem.c does things like
    
            sem->count = RWSEM_UNLOCKED_VALUE;
    
    Now, if you mix in the fact that atomic_* types are actually structures
    with one member and note typedefs of a scalar, it makes its really nasty.
    
    So I stuck to what we did before using a long and casts for now.
